断裂体系对海岸线分形性质与分维值的影响
EFFECT OF FAULT SYSTEM ON THE FRACTAL FEATURE AND DIMENSION OF COASTLINE
【摘要】 理论分析、计算模拟以及实例验证表明,断裂体系对于海岸线的发育及其分形性质有着重要的影响。如果海岸线发育受到两组或者多组不同方向断裂的影响,并且影响程度相当或者比较接近,那么海岸线的分维值较大;如果海岸线倾向于由单一方向的一组断裂控制,那么海岸线的分维值较小。福建海岸主要受到NE向和NW向两组断裂的控制,因此海岸线的分维值较大;台湾东海岸受单一方向(NNE向)大断裂的控制,海岸线分维值接近于1 0。该项研究对加深海岸线分形机理的认识具有重要的意义。
【Abstract】 A computation model is set up to test the effect of fault system on the fractal feature and dimension of coastline. A comparison study is done between the computation results and the measure results of the coastline of Fujian and Taiwan, China. It suggests that the fault system in a region plays a very important role in the formation of the coastline and its fractal nature. The coastline would have a big value of fractal dimension when it is controlled simultaneously by two or more faults in different directions, otherwise it would have a small fractal dimension value. When it is controlled by only one fault or by faults in the same direction, the value of fractal dimension of the coastline would be close to 1.0.
